導航:首頁 > 外匯期貨 > 期貨量化交易matlab

期貨量化交易matlab

發布時間:2024-05-26 21:08:38

『壹』 金融工程,量化投資學什麼軟體好Python還是Matlab

個人覺得還是都會比較好。技多不壓身。量化投資用Matlab 和 C++,一個建模一個執行,足夠了。實在不愛用Matlab的話,R和Python也行。

選擇python推薦可以閱讀:《量化投資:以python為工具》主要講解量化投資的思想和策略,並藉助Python 語言進行實戰。《量化投資:以Python為工具》一共分為5 部分,第1 部分是Python 入門,第2 部分是統計學基礎,第3 部分是金融理論、投資組合與量化選股,第4 部分是時間序列簡介與配對交易,第5 部分是技術指標與量化投資。《量化投資:以Python為工具》首先對Python 編程語言進行介紹,通過學習,讀者可以迅速掌握用Python 語言處理數據的方法,並靈活運用Python 解決實際金融問題;其次,向讀者介紹量化投資的理論知識,主要講解量化投資所需的數量基礎和類型等方面;最後講述如何在Python 語言中構建量化投資策略。

選擇MATLAB推薦閱讀:《問道量化投資:用MATLAB來敲門》主要講述以MATLAB為分析工具的量化投資,由「MATLAB入門」、「MATLAB量化投資基礎」和「MATLAB量化投資相關函數詳解」3篇組成。入門篇讓零編程基礎的讀者快速掌握強大的數值計算和模擬分析工具MATLAB;量化投資基礎篇簡要介紹相關的投資策略及模型,重點講述MATLAB中的模型實現及應用;函數詳解篇對MATLAB的金融工具箱、衍生品工具箱和固定收益工具箱中的全部函數一一進行詳解,以幫助讀者快速掌握這些函數。

『貳』 量化交易里的matlab主要用來干什麼

首先有一些交易的思路,不許能夠把它說出來,在紙上變成明確的交易邏輯,有很多人用盤感下單,有些人每次下單的原因都不一樣,每次都可以找出不同的交易進出場決定。但是,如果你是想做程序化交易,就必須要有明確且具體的買賣點操作邏輯,可以被完全量化。交易規則要合乎邏輯,比如只有買進沒有賣出的邏輯就是無法構成一個完整的交易策略。使用matlab按照一些常用的規則不如構造指標,寫入買賣邏輯,進行整合交易策略。這個就可以使用Auto-Trader編寫,寫入代碼就是純matlab代碼,只有一些調用的API。都是純matlab語言,並不難。編寫好一個策略之後,我們需要拿到歷史上某段時間段,某一指定頻率的測試。必須看起來還可以,比如曲線往上行,或者損失並沒有損失非常多的錢,如果回撤非常巨大就要進入分析最大回撤段的原因。這個可以在策略分析模塊有比較詳盡的分析。把該策略在多個品種、周期上測試,查看績效表現。採用組合優化選取參數,交叉驗證,分樣本外樣本內檢驗。可以使用各種優化目標進行優化挑選參數。最優化這一部分必須非常小心,容易出現過度擬合的情形,這個是整個策略開發非常重要的一步,一般會採用walk forward 分析,重抽樣技術來做一些策略過擬合檢驗。觀察分析在不同的市場結構裡面策略的表現情況,這一部分後面會有更為詳盡的敘述,當然本人是不建議進行優化操作的。

『叄』 有沒有懂期貨日內量化交易策略和matlab的能幫助一下

這個屬於一字漲停的數據,就是開盤直接封板,這個沒有什麼機會做什麼交易策略了,換個品種交易吧。
期貨量化策略研究指的是需要依據一種或多種確鑿的獲利理念,通過某一特定顯式表示的模型,指導參與者反復地以人工或機器執行指令,參與單邊或多空交易,在策略的執行過程中,需要實時監控資產組合價值與目標利潤的偏離情況,調整參數,直到已有模型生命期限終了,再轉入到新模型。
期貨量化策略就是我們指的是採用特定量化指標及數據來進行交易的策略,平常那個說的程序化交易是其中一種,量化交易的原理及要求都比較專業化。

『肆』 量化投資中,MATLAB和python哪一個好

Matlab在矩陣處理方面的強大優勢Python無法比擬,我曾經用Matlab和Python跑同一個演算法,涉及到矩陣中Symbol求導。Python用的是Numpy,Sympy和Scipy,感覺Sympy中Matrix雖然功能強大,但是速度很慢,而且需要專注其中各種細節。如:其對Complex類型是無法自動expand的,常常出現(1+I)(2I+1)這種結果,這時需要調用.expand來解決。Matlab可以使你專注於模型,Python要超過Matlab還需要時間。但是Python在內容抓取,機器學習,等有強大的第三方包,如Scarpy,Skikit-learn等,發展很快。概括之:現在用Matlab,未來用Python

『伍』 如何利用matlab對交易策略進行回測

這個很簡單啊,我現在就在用matlab做期貨量化的回測呢
關鍵的構成:
一是:形成自己策略的思想和流程圖
二是:從TB或者其他軟體中導出需要的tick等級別的數據,根據自己的思想和流程圖編輯程序,最好多使用function函數句柄,是程序的可適性增強。
三是:繪制圖片,plot,mesh或者GUI,來觀測自己參數對策略的影響,進而進一步完善策略
四是:多用cell元胞數組,根據TB等回測報告形成自己的測試報告,比如空多盈虧,回撤等等。

『陸』 matlab做量化投資分析,怎麼學

Matlab是一個高級的矩陣/陣列語言,它包含控制語句、函數、數據結構、輸入和輸出和面向對象編程特點。用戶可以在命令窗口中將輸入語句與執行命令同步,也可以先編寫好一個較大的復雜的應用程序(M文件)後再一起運行。新版本的MATLAB語言是基於最為流行的C++語言基礎上的,因此語法特徵與C++語言極為相似,而且更加簡單,更加符合科技人員對數學表達式的書寫格式。使之更利於非計算機專業的科技人員使用。而且這種語言可移植性好、可拓展性極強,這也是MATLAB能夠深入到科學研究及工程計算各個領域的重要原因。

溫馨提示:以上解釋僅供參考。
應答時間:2021-10-09,最新業務變化請以平安銀行官網公布為准。
[平安銀行我知道]想要知道更多?快來看「平安銀行我知道」吧~
https://b.pingan.com.cn/paim/iknow/index.html

閱讀全文

與期貨量化交易matlab相關的資料

熱點內容
外匯平台周六周日可以出金嗎 瀏覽:962
法院審理泛亞金融有限公司 瀏覽:486
不終止確認的金融資產 瀏覽:337
中金所期權產品多少杠桿 瀏覽:425
長春市住房公積金貸款額度 瀏覽:528
奈及利亞奈拉匯率美元黑市 瀏覽:660
歐元與美金匯率 瀏覽:787
大淘客改傭金 瀏覽:323
同方股份2018第四季度業績 瀏覽:383
哪項不是郵儲銀行個人客戶理財產品系列 瀏覽:55
深圳中贏財富金融公司 瀏覽:694
濟南金融機構 瀏覽:870
銀行間理財區別 瀏覽:972
蘭州黃河000929股票 瀏覽:983
財政部干預匯率的方式 瀏覽:798
金融服務質量的構成要素 瀏覽:473
9月5日匯率日元 瀏覽:957
日幣兌換怎麼兌換人民幣匯率 瀏覽:462
網路開戶怎麼調傭金 瀏覽:140
起步股份漲幅預計 瀏覽:661